You'd have to be living underground not to be aware of the tremendous trend to increased evaluation and measurement for training and development. Everywhere we turn, there's increased pressure for accountability and a need to show the impact of training in a variety of ways, using different types of measures.

When we conduct our workshops on Measuring Return on Investment (over 500 have been conducted in thirty-two countries, with 10,000 participants), many frequently asked questions involve the measurement at other levels in addition to ROI. Though we stress that organizations measure a variety of issues, including ROI, most participants ask, "Although I understand the need for ROI, how can I measure the actual learning that takes place and how it is being applied on the job?" Practitioners need to know how to measure, at all levels from reaction and satisfaction to learning, application, business impact, and ROI. These days, practitioners are desperately seeking help with measuring learning and application the focus of this book.

Though excellent progress has been made in measuring reaction and satisfaction, many practitioners are struggling with efficient and effective ways to measure learning and application. They also recognize that, from the client's perspective, data on learning and application are more valuable than reaction data.
